Subfloor Water Damage Repair Cost in South Pasadena, CA

Subfloor water damage repair costs vary based on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ions in South Pasadena, CA. These estimates are based on our team’s experience and expertise. Get a free estimate today to find out the cost of your subfloor repair.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Subfloor Inspection and Assessment $200 – $500 Severity of damage, size of affected area
Water Extraction and Drying $500 – $2,500 Amount of water, type of equipment used
Subfloor Repair and Replacement $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of materials used
Final Inspection and Clean-up $200 – $500 Complexity of repair, amount of debris
Emergency Response (24/7) $500 – $2,000 Time of day, severity of damage
More Services (mold remediation, etc.) $500 – $2,000 Severity of damage, type of service

Common Questions About Subfloor Water Damage Repair

How Long Does Subfloor Water Damage Repair Take?

Our team works efficiently to complete subfloor repairs within 3-5 days. But, the actual time frame depends on the severity of the damage and the complexity of the repair. We’ll provide a detailed timeline during your free estimate.

Is Subfloor Water Damage Repair Covered by Insurance?

Yes, subfloor water damage repair is usually covered by homeowners insurance. But, the specifics depend on your policy and the circumstances surrounding the damage. We’ll work with your insurance company to ensure a smooth claims process.

Can I Prevent Subfloor Water Damage?

Yes, regular maintenance and inspections can help prevent subfloor water damage. Check your subfloor regularly for signs of damage or moisture, and address any issues quickly.
